Responsibilities as a
Landscape Irrigation Technician:
Install irrigation systems, connecting pipes, valves, and sprinklers. Install controllers, timers, and sensors for automation. Inspect and test systems regularly; diagnose and repair leaks, clogs, and broken parts. Perform routine maintenance tasks like cleaning filters and replacing parts. Upgrade systems for efficiency; install drip lines and rain sensors. Reprogram controllers and timers to optimize watering schedules. Resolve issues with water pressure, electrical connections, and programming. Use diagnostic tools to locate underground leaks and blockages. Explain system operations and maintenance to clients. Provide recommendations for improving irrigation efficiency. Conduct seasonal adjustments like winterizing and spring reactivation. Work with landscape designers, project managers, and other team members. Maintain documentation, work logs and communicate effectively utilizing Google Suite. Qualifications for
